2025 Men's Lacrosse

39 Anthony Samiotes

  • Height 6-0
  • Weight 210
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Hampstead, N.H.
  • Highschool Pinkerton Academy

Biography

Accolades:
All-GNAC: Third Team (2022, 2023)
CSC Academic All-District (2023)
GNAC All-Rookie Team (2022)
GNAC All-Academic: 2023

2023: Played and started in 16 games as a sophmore defender... tallied one goal, 70 ground balls and 44 caused turnovers... recorded 10 ground balls and seven caused turnovers in a 19-2 win against New England College... netted one goal, nine ground balls and six caused turnovers in a 16-2 win against Norwich University... gathered seven ground balls and two caused turnovers in a 11-8 victory against Johnson and Wales University... collected All-GNAC:Third Team, CSC Academic All-District and GNAC All-Academic. 

2022: Played in all 18 games and started in 16 as a freshman defender…had at least two caused turnovers in nine games…grabbed a ground ball and two caused turnovers in his first collegiate game on Feb. 23rd at University of New England…had an assist, two ground balls, and two caused turnovers against Wentworth Institute on Mar. 9th…had a season high of eight ground balls and three caused turnovers on Mar. 31st defeating New England College 13-4…a few days later picked up four ground balls and tallied two caused turnovers at Johnson & Wales University…when facing Emmanuel College he garnered four ground balls and a caused turnover on Apr. 9th…on Apr. 23rd had five ground balls and two caused turnovers against University of St. Joseph…repeated both stats during the quarterfinal game at Norwich University on Apr. 29th.

Why Saint Joseph's? Great atmosphere and home-like feel.

High School: Participated in lacrosse, unified basketball, soccer, and basketball at Pinkerton Academy…helped his team win a pair of New Hampshire Division 1 State Championships…member of the National Honor Society, National Technical Honor Society, and Foreign Language Honor Society…also a New Hampshire Scholar…played club for 4 Leaf Lacrosse for eight years.

Community Service: Helped at local food pantry, helped run a kid's youth group at St. Anne's Parish, volunteered at Hampstead Recreation Events such as 4th of July fireworks, Christmas Tree Lighting, and Memorial Golf Tournaments…also volunteered at school through yearly Egg Hunt, Coach's yard cleanup, and food drives.

Personal: Anthony Charles Samiotes, son of Jennifer and George Samiotes…has two siblings, Julia and Evan.
